Geography
Greek word Geographia or the earth description
The science that studies the lands,the features,
the inhabitants and the phenomena of the earth.

Forms of Land
Continent
Large mass of land
Other forms of land
Archipelago
A number of islands surrounded by water
Cape
A projection of land into water
-
7/28/2019 2 Principles of Geography and Basic Terms
21/25
Forms of land
Elevation
The height of land above the sea level
Island
A form of land surrounded by water
Isthmus
A narrow strip of land between two large bodies
of water Mountains
Elevated terrestrial masses that are peaked

Forms of Land
Plateau
Elevated terrestrial masses that is flat
Peninsula
Large projection of land into water
Volcano
Elevated terrestrial masses that has lava

Other bodies of water
Bay
Body of water that sticks out into land
Gulf
Large bodies of water that sticks out into land
Fjords
Narrow inlets of sea between cliffs or steep slopes
Lakes
Bodies of water surrounded by land
